Laguna Lăng Cô Golf Club: Generally regarded as one of Vietnam's best courses, this Nick Faldo design is laid out between the azure waters of the East Vietnam Sea and an impressive jungle-clad coastal mountain range. The out-and-back layout wanders through six different habitats, which include (in the order you arrive at them): water, rice paddies, woodland, duneland, beach and sandy "blowouts".
Although close to the sea, most of the time you are tucked away behind a dense area of coastal trees and a small canal. You cross the canal in front of the par-4 10th green. Only at the short and tight par-4 9th hole do you really get beachside. There's plenty of golfing challenge in this eclectic and exuberant layout, but it's a course where you hanker for a bit more exposure to sea views ... and beachside golf.

Laguna Lăng Cô resort and golf course takes its name from the village of Lăng Cô, which is located 20 km southeast of the golf course. The village occupies a thin peninsula of land, sandwiched between the Lap An Lagoon and the South China Sea. The area is known for its seafood stalls and for the long, white-sand Lăng Cô Beach.

Here at Prince’s Golf Club you'll find 27 excellent holes of links golf. Just over the fence and sharing similar terrain is Royal St George’s; but Prince’s is far from overshadowed by its venerable neighbour. The three nine-hole loops at Prince's, laid out over gently undulating terrain, are sure to bring a smile of satisfaction to all lovers of links golf.
